A new study shows that even the smallest amount of light during sleep, such as the light from a phone screen at its lowest brightness, is associated with potentially damaging changes in the structure and function of the heart. According to the findings of this study, light pollution during nighttime sleep, even at the level of moonlight or a beam coming through a crack in the door, can affect human heart health.
Effects of Light on the Cardiovascular System
In this study, researchers examined the effects of light on the cardiovascular system and concluded that low-light conditions, especially at night, can disrupt the normal functioning of the heart. This research shows that light can affect biological activities in the body even at low levels, leading to changes in heart rate and blood pressure.

Strategies to Reduce Light Pollution
To reduce light pollution and maintain heart health, several actions can be taken. These actions include using thick curtains to block light from entering the bedroom, utilizing low and natural light during nighttime, and reducing the use of digital screens before sleep. Additionally, changing sleep habits and adjusting sleep schedules to sleep during dark hours can be effective.
